The concept of harnessing solar energy can be traced back to the 19th century when French physicist Edmond Becquerel first discovered the photovoltaic effect in 1839. However, it was not until 1954 when Bell Laboratories engineers Daryl Chapin, Calvin Souther Fuller, and Gerald Pearson developed the first practical silicon solar cell, marking a significant milestone in solar technology. This early solar cell had an efficiency of around 6%, a far cry from the efficiency levels we achieve today.

Over the years, significant advancements have been made in solar cell technology. Improvements in materials, manufacturing processes, and design have led to higher efficiencies and reduced costs, making solar energy increasingly competitive with conventional fossil fuel-based electricity generation.
However, some challenges still persist. One major issue is the intermittency of solar power due to variations in sunlight throughout the day and across different weather conditions. To address this, energy storage solutions like batteries and grid integration strategies are being developed to store excess solar energy and ensure a steady power supply.
